<?xml version="1.0" encoding="UTF-8"?> <ruleset x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" name="Ruleset" xmlns="http://pmd.sf.net/ruleset/1.0.0" xsi:schemaLocation="http://pmd.sf.net/ruleset/1.0.0 http://pmd.sf.net/ruleset_xml_schema.xsd"> <description>Ruleset for PHP Mess Detector that enforces coding standards</description> <rule ref="rulesets/cleancode.xml"> <exclude name="ElseExpression"/> </rule> <rule ref="rulesets/codesize.xml"/> <rule ref="rulesets/controversial.xml"/> <rule ref="rulesets/design.xml"> <exclude name="CouplingBetweenObjects"/> </rule> <rule ref="rulesets/naming.xml"> <exclude name="LongVariable"/> <exclude name="ShortVariable"/> <exclude name="ShortMethodName"/> </rule> <rule ref="rulesets/naming.xml/ShortVariable"> <properties> <property name="exceptions" value="id"/> </properties> </rule> <rule ref="rulesets/naming.xml/ShortMethodName"> <properties> <property name="exceptions" value="up"/> </properties> </rule> <rule ref="rulesets/unusedcode.xml"> <!-- PHPMD cannot recognize parameters that are enforced by an interface --> <exclude name="UnusedFormalParameter"/> </rule> </ruleset>